The Enigmatic Beauty of The Edge of the Forest by Camille Corot

Exploring the Artistic Techniques of Camille Corot

Brushwork and Color Palette: A Study in Naturalism

Camille Corot, a master of landscape painting, employed a unique brushwork technique that captures the essence of nature. His use of soft, feathery strokes creates a sense of movement in the foliage. The color palette features rich greens, earthy browns, and subtle blues, reflecting the tranquility of the forest. This harmonious blend of colors enhances the painting's naturalism, inviting viewers to immerse themselves in the serene woodland scene.

Light and Shadow: The Play of Dappled Sunlight

Corot skillfully manipulates light and shadow to evoke a sense of depth and realism. The dappled sunlight filters through the trees, casting gentle shadows on the forest floor. This interplay of light creates a dynamic atmosphere, making the viewer feel as if they are stepping into the scene. The luminous quality of the painting highlights Corot's ability to capture fleeting moments in nature.

The Historical Context of The Edge of the Forest

Romanticism and the Influence of Nature in 19th Century Art

Created during the Romantic era, The Edge of the Forest embodies the movement's fascination with nature and emotion. Artists sought to express the sublime beauty of the natural world, often portraying landscapes as reflections of human feelings. Corot's work aligns with this ideology, showcasing the forest as a place of beauty and introspection.

Corot's Role in the Barbizon School Movement

As a pivotal figure in the Barbizon School, Corot influenced a generation of artists who sought to paint en plein air, or outdoors. This approach allowed for a more authentic representation of nature. His dedication to capturing the essence of the French countryside laid the groundwork for future movements, including Impressionism. Corot's legacy continues to resonate in contemporary landscape painting.

Symbolism and Themes in The Edge of the Forest

Nature as a Reflection of Human Emotion

In The Edge of the Forest, nature serves as a mirror for human emotions. The tranquil setting invites contemplation and introspection. The lush greenery and serene atmosphere evoke feelings of peace and solitude, allowing viewers to connect with their inner selves. Corot's portrayal of nature emphasizes its role in emotional expression.

The Forest: A Metaphor for Solitude and Serenity

The forest in Corot's painting symbolizes solitude and serenity. It represents a refuge from the chaos of modern life. The winding path through the trees invites viewers to embark on a personal journey, exploring their thoughts and emotions. This metaphorical interpretation adds depth to the artwork, making it a timeless piece that resonates with audiences.

Unique Features of The Edge of the Forest

Composition and Perspective: A Journey into the Woods

Corot's composition in The Edge of the Forest draws the viewer's eye into the depths of the woodland. The carefully arranged elements create a sense of perspective, leading the viewer on a visual journey. The path meanders through the trees, inviting exploration and discovery. This thoughtful arrangement enhances the immersive experience of the painting.

Characterization of Trees and Foliage: A Detailed Examination

The trees and foliage in Corot's painting are characterized by their intricate details and vibrant colors. Each tree is uniquely rendered, showcasing Corot's keen observation of nature. The varied textures of the leaves and bark add richness to the scene. This attention to detail elevates the painting, making it a stunning representation of the natural world.

The Influence of The Edge of the Forest on Modern Art

How Corot Inspired Impressionism and Beyond

Corot's innovative techniques and emphasis on light and color significantly influenced the Impressionist movement. Artists like Claude Monet and Pierre-Auguste Renoir drew inspiration from Corot's ability to capture the fleeting effects of light in nature. His legacy continues to inspire modern artists who seek to explore the relationship between light, color, and emotion in their work.

The Legacy of Landscape Painting in Contemporary Art

The Edge of the Forest remains a cornerstone of landscape painting, influencing countless artists throughout history. Its themes of nature, solitude, and emotional depth resonate in contemporary art. Today, artists continue to explore the beauty of landscapes, often referencing Corot's techniques and philosophies. The painting's enduring legacy highlights the timeless appeal of nature in art.
